This is a multi-part message in MIME format. ---------------------- multipart/alternative attachment For those who followed the PDF thread awhile back and are interested in = just what it is and how you might get it, the following information may = be of use and is a supplement to the information already provided by Joe = Garrett. Trefz Pin Driving Fluid is, apparently, a phenolic resin without the = addition of any of the typical dryers (solvents) added by various = manufacturers to create their own products. In other words, it is the = raw material from which certain types of varnishes are made. Rodda = paint in Oregon carries such a product known as 1067-S1. If you live in = Oregon or Washington you can buy the product from a Rodda Paint dealer = for about $15.00 per gallon. =20 Rodda Paint gets the product from a company called McWhorter = Technologies, Inc., in Carpentersville, IL 60110, 1-888-CALL-MWT. It is = known as H354B, Product code 207 1196, Product Name Duramac 207-1196. If you contact McWhorter, you might find out which companies in your = area purchase the raw material for production and buy it before they add = their own formula of solvents. =20 FYI Schaff still sells Trefz Pin Driving Fluid in 4oz bottles. They do = not list it in their catalogue, but it is available upon request. David Love ---------------------- multipart/alternative attachment An HTML attachment was scrubbed...
